NKK Switches Co., Ltd. Q1 FY2027 Analysis: Strong Demand Fuels Profitability Surge
NKK Switches Co., Ltd., a major manufacturer of industrial small switches renowned for its toggle switches, reported robust first-quarter results for the fiscal year ending March 2027 (Q1). The company achieved significant top-line growth, with Revenue reaching JPY 2.65bn (+45.1% YoY), driven by a strong recovery in end-market demand and inventory normalization across its key operational regions in Japan and Asia.
| Metric | Current Period (JPY) | Year-over-Year Change |
|---|---|---|
| Revenue | JPY 2.65bn | +45.1% YoY |
| Operating Profit | JPY 339M | N/A YoY |
| Ordinary Income | JPY 396M | N/A YoY |
| Net Profit | JPY 322M | N/A YoY |
| Operating Margin | 12.8% | - |
| Equity Ratio | 84.8% (prev: 86.2%) | - |
NKK Switches Co., Ltd. specializes in manufacturing industrial small switches, maintaining a strong market presence through its reliable toggle switch product line across Japan and Asia, with significant focus on the North American market.
The Q1 performance signals more than just revenue recovery; it indicates a qualitative improvement in profitability. The shift of Operating Profit from a loss in the prior year period to JPY 339M highlights a substantial structural enhancement in the company’s earnings quality. This strong operational momentum, coupled with high margins, suggests effective cost management alongside volume increases.
The underlying strength appears linked to broader industry tailwinds. Management noted that the overall demand environment is being uplifted by expanding AI-related investments, particularly within data center infrastructure. Strategically, NKK Switches Co., Ltd. is focusing on deepening penetration in specific sectors—such as broadcasting audio equipment and specialized vehicles—while simultaneously strengthening its supply chain integration across design, manufacturing, and sales (生販一体). Furthermore, the Equity Ratio remains at a high 84.8%, underscoring exceptional financial stability.
Full-Year Guidance
Management has provided an updated full-year forecast for the fiscal year ending March 2027:
| Metric | Forecast (JPY) | YoY Change |
|---|---|---|
| Revenue | JPY 9.60bn | +14.6% |
| Operating Profit | JPY 340M | +21.1% |
| Ordinary Income | JPY 440M | +7.9% |
| Net Profit | JPY 308M | +5.3% |
The full-year guidance suggests a positive trajectory, with both revenue and operating profit showing clear growth expectations compared to the prior fiscal year. The target for Operating Profit implies continued margin expansion momentum into the second half of the fiscal year.
Key Considerations for International Investors
- Profitability Quality: The most striking takeaway is the simultaneous achievement of high revenue growth (45.1% YoY) and significant profit improvement, demonstrating that the company is successfully capturing value from market recovery rather than simply increasing volume through discounting.
- AI Sector Tailwinds: The direct linkage between increased AI-related investment spending and improved order intake provides a clear secular growth narrative underpinning the current performance cycle.
- Supply Chain Vigilance: While operational execution has been strong, management’s acknowledgment of potential risks related to raw material price inflation and global geopolitical instability warrants continued monitoring regarding cost control measures in subsequent quarters.
